“Community solar is an increasingly popular solar option.

As of January 2016 there were 58 utility-managed community solar programs operating nearly 60 megawatts (MW) nationally, and 21 third-party managed ones operating an additional 50 MW – with many more planned to come online this year.However, recent actions by state regulators in Vermont and Illinois, and a potential class action lawsuit in Vermont, have raised the importance of renewable energy certificates (RECs) management in program design and marketing. SEPA’s Mike Taylor led a focused presentation on SEPA’s recently released Member Brief about RECs and Community Solar. Whether you operate a community solar program or are an interested stakeholder, approaching RECs in a deliberate manner makes good business sense.”
